Price Comparison
When comparing prices, the Rii Wireless Keyboard and Mouse Combo is significantly more affordable at C$19.79, while the Logitech MK345 Wireless Combo is priced at C$64.00. This represents a price difference of C$44.21, making the Rii option a budget-friendly choice for those seeking a basic wireless keyboard and mouse setup. However, the higher price of the Logitech product may be justifiable for users looking for additional features and build quality, as it offers a more comprehensive typing experience.
Design and Build Quality
The Logitech MK345 boasts a full-sized keyboard with a spill-resistant design and a comfortable palm rest, which enhances comfort during long typing sessions. In contrast, the Rii Wireless Keyboard also features a full-size layout but is designed with foldable stands that allow for an adjustable typing angle. While both products are made for comfort, the Logitech's spill-resistant feature adds an extra layer of durability, making it more suitable for everyday use, particularly in environments where spills might occur.

Typing Experience
The typing experience differs significantly between the two options. The Logitech MK345 is designed for comfortable and quiet typing, featuring a familiar layout that includes easy-access media keys for tasks like muting and adjusting volume. The Rii Wireless Keyboard, while also full-sized, highlights its low-profile keys that promote quiet typing, making it suitable for shared environments. However, the absence of dedicated media keys in the Rii could be a drawback for users who frequently use multimedia functions during their work or leisure activities.
Mouse Comfort and Features
When it comes to the mouse included in each combo, the Logitech MK345 features a contoured design that supports right-handed users, offering smooth and precise tracking for easier navigation. On the other hand, the Rii Wireless Mouse caters to both left- and right-handed users, providing versatility. It also includes adjustable DPI settings (800-1600), which can enhance navigation efficiency for various tasks. While both mice are comfortable, users may prefer the tailored design of the Logitech mouse for extended use.
Battery Life
The battery life is another crucial aspect where the Logitech MK345 excels, offering up to 3 years of battery life for the keyboard and 18 months for the mouse, which is impressive for a wireless combo. In contrast, the Rii Wireless Keyboard requires one AAA battery and the mouse requires one AA battery, but specifics on battery life are not provided. This disparity suggests that the Logitech MK345 could save users from frequent battery replacements, making it a more convenient option for daily use.
